The company's founder and CEO, Emad Mostaque, an investor with a background in computers, tried to start an identity SaaS company in 2019, but failed to succeed. However, instead of giving up, he founded Stability AI again at the end of 2020 with the initial aim of creating an AI open source platform.

Stability AI's latest innovation is Stable Audio, a platform that automatically generates music or audio based on textual content entered by the user. The release of this innovative tool marks an important breakthrough for Stability AI in the field of AI music creation.

The free version of Stable Audio can generate music clips of up to 20 seconds, while users can generate audio content of up to 90 seconds after purchasing a Pro subscription.
